Mandragora, better known as Mandrake, is a plant belonging to the nightshade family. It is primarily found in the Mediterranean regions and the Middle East. The roots of this plant are known for their distinctive shape, often resembling human figures.
Mandragora has a long history in mythology and folklore. In ancient times, it was often associated with magical properties. Its roots were considered magical remedies and were used in various traditional rituals. Furthermore, Mandrake is mentioned in numerous literary works, which underlines its mystical reputation.
